The Blackhawks will likely turn to Mrazek for the third straight game on Thursday when they host the San Jose Sharks. Despite a 1-2-0 record, Mrazek has been solid for the Blackhawks to start the season, showcasing a 2.71 GAA and .911 SV%, nearly mirroring the 3.05 GAA and .907 SV% he had last season. The Blackhawks enter the action on Thursday as -183 home favorites against a Sharks club that was defeated 3-2 in a shootout by the Dallas Stars in their previous game.
